Quest. Why doth he not require the like kindness to Mephibosheth the son of his dear Jonathan?



Answ. Either he and his were now extinct, or by their after-miscarriages had forfeited his favour.



For so, i.e. with such kindness either as I cannot express, (as the particle so is elsewhere used,) or as I command thee to show to them.



They, i.e. Barzillai and his sons; for though Barzillai only be mentioned, 2Sa_17:27, yet his sons doubtless were instrumental in the business, especially Chimham, 2Sa_19:37,38.
